Part 1. How to Set Spotify as the Default Music Player on Windows and Mac

mac spotify cannot open music files

By default, Spotify is mainly built for streaming music from its catalog, and it doesn't automatically become the default music player on Windows or Mac. Unlike apps like VLC or WMP, Spotify isn't set to open every music file on your computer. Apple Music (or iTunes) works differently, but Spotify is designed primarily as a streaming service rather than a general music player.

Workaround 1: Upload and Play Local Music Files in Spotify

spotify desktop local files playlist

If you want to play your own music files in Spotify, you can upload them to the Spotify desktop app. Once added, your files appear alongside Spotify's streaming library, making them easy to access. You don't need a Premium subscription to do this on desktop, and the uploaded files stay in your library for convenient playback.

  1. Open the Spotify desktop app on your Windows or Mac computer and log in to your account.
  2. Go to Settings by clicking your profile icon, then scroll down to Local Files and toggle it on.
  3. Click "Add a Source" and select the folder where your personal music files are stored. Spotify will scan the folder and add your songs to the Local Files library.
  4. Create a new playlist and drag your uploaded songs into it for easy access.
  5. Open the playlist and click Play. Your local files will now play inside Spotify alongside streaming tracks.

Step 2: Set Default Music Player on Desktop to Play Spotify Music

For Windows:

  1. Go to Settings (Gear icon) from Start, or search for "Settings" in the Windows Search box.
  2. Click Apps, then select Default apps in the left sidebar.
  3. Scroll to Music player, click the current option, and choose a player where you uploaded your Spotify music.

  5. To set default apps by file type, scroll down to Default apps > Choose default apps by file type and select your preferred player for each music format.

For Mac:

  1. Open a Finder window and locate any music file you downloaded (e.g., MP3 or M4A).
  2. Right-click (or Control-click) the file and select Open With, then choose a media player you want to use.
  3. Alternatively, select Get Info from the context menu, go to Open With, and select your desired player.

  5. Click Change All below the dropdown menu to apply this choice to all files of that type.
  6. From now on, double-clicking a music file of that type will automatically open it with your chosen media player.

Part 2. How to Set Spotify as the Default Music Player on Smart Speakers

It's easy to play your favorite songs from smart speakers. But by default, they usually choose which service to use if you don't specify one, like Spotify. Playback will start on the service the device decides, such as Apple Music for HomePod or Amazon Music for Google Home or Nest.

However, if you prefer Spotify, you can set it as the default music player so your songs play there instead. Some devices, like Apple HomePod, make it a bit trickier because they stick to Apple Music and lack full Spotify integration. But most of the time, you don't have to say "on Spotify" every time you play music. Set it once, and it will remember your preference going forward.

Option 1: Google Nest / Google Home (Google Assistant)

Many Google Home users don't want to say "on Spotify" every time they play music. You can set Spotify as the default, so playlists, albums, or favorite songs start automatically. This is especially useful for routines or multi-user households. Once set, Google Home remembers your preference.

  1. Open the Google Home app on your phone and log in with your Google account.
  2. Tap on Add + at the top left then tap Music to choose Spotify.

  4. A prompt will show up asking you to link your Spotify account with your Google account. Then tap Link account.

  6. Under Your Music Services, select Spotify as the default music player on your Google Home.

Option 2: Amazon Echo (Alexa)

Setting Spotify as the default on Alexa means voice requests play from Spotify without extra steps. It's convenient for car trips, workouts, or cooking, where saying "on Spotify" each time can be annoying. Once configured, Alexa will automatically use Spotify for all music commands.

  1. Open the Alexa app on your phone.
  2. Tap on the three-lined menu at the top left corner and select Settings.
  3. Under Alexa Preferences, tap Music & Podcasts > Default Services.
  4. Tap Change and select Spotify then hit Done.

Option 3: Apple HomePod (Siri)

HomePod doesn't let Spotify be a full default, but you can still play it using Siri by saying, "Hey Siri, play [song or playlist] on Spotify." You can also stream via AirPlay from your iPhone. This is a popular workaround for HomePod users who prefer Spotify.

Option 4: Sonos Speakers

Setting Spotify as the default on Sonos lets all voice requests play directly from Spotify. Many users rely on this for multi-speaker setups or daily listening, so asking the speaker to play a song or playlist always uses Spotify.

  1. Open the Sonos app on your phone and go to the Settings tab.
  2. Tap on Services & Voice, then press Sonos Voice Control.
  3. Press Default Service.
  4. Select Spotify from the list and set it as your default service.

Part 3. How to Make Spotify the Default Music Player on Android Devices

  1. On your Android device, open the Settings app.
  2. Select Applications Manager > Apps.
  3. Select Default apps/applications.
  4. From there you can change the default music player to Spotify for various actions like opening music links or playing music files.

Part 4. How to Make Spotify the Default Music Player on iPhone and iPad

If you want to use Spotify as the default music player on your iPhone or Android device, then you can carefully read this part. In this part, we've listed the ways to help you set Spotify as the default player on your iPhone or Android phone.

How to set a default music player on iOS:

  1. On your iOS device, open the Settings app.
  2. Scroll down and tap on "Siri & Search".
  3. Scroll through the list of apps here and select the Spotify app.
  4. Look for the option called "Use with Ask Siri" and enable it.
  5. Once you set Spotify as the default music player on your device, you should be able to ask Siri to play music using Spotify by saying "Hey Siri, play 'song name' on Spotify".

If you couldn't find the "Use with Ask Siri" option, you may has already set another music service on your iOS device as the default music player, such as Apple Music.

If so, you can try turning off "Show Apple Music" under the Music settings and uninstalling that music service from your iOS device. Then, try to use Spotify with Siri instead by saying "Hey Siri, play music." and see if you're promoted to change your default music player. If you're out of luck, you can also try offloading the Music app and try to force Siri to use Spotify instead when asking for music.
